WASHINGTON D.C.: The U.S. State Department has called upon Vietnam to release environmental advocate Nguy Thi Khanh, adding that the U.S. was “deeply concerned” by her 17th June sentencing to prison.
In a statement, the State Department said, “The U.S. calls on the government of Vietnam to release Khanh, who has been recognized internationally for her work to advance climate change and sustainable energy issues
